Artificial Intelligence (AI) and robotics play an increasingly important role in our society and economy. But nowadays these technologies are impacting very skilled work kind of jobs. Mankind is on the brink of the fourth industrial revolution, in which robotics and artificial intelligence are expected to have disruptive effects on the types of tasks performed by humans. This big disruption has two sides: lost jobs and concern for society. On the other hand, greatly increased profitability for many businesses. Some warn that it could lead to the creation of super firms’ hubs of wealth and knowledge that could have detrimental effects on the bigger economy. It may also widen the gap between developed and developing countries, and boost the need for employees with certain skills while rendering others redundant this latter trend could have far-reaching consequences for the labor market. This review provides a short overview of the ongoing discourse on the impact of diffusion and adoption of robotic and artificial intelligence on a different sector.
